Main national accounts tax aggregates
Slovenia, 2003
In 2003, Slovenia's main national accounts tax aggregates decreased by 1.3% compared to 2002, reaching 15.2%.
The figure is above the EU-27 average of 14.5%.
Slovenia ranks 5th out of 27 EU member states with reported data — in the top half of the distribution.
Over the past five years, the indicator has grown by 0.0% (from 15.2% in 1998).
